Investment firm Jefferies has outlined several potential catalysts that could support Devon Energy (DVN) in the wake of its recent strategic transaction involving Coterra Energy. The analysis highlights operational synergies and market positioning as key factors that may drive the company forward.

The firm reportedly views the transaction as a catalyst that could unlock value through enhanced scale, improved asset quality, and operational efficiencies. Jefferies noted that the combination may strengthen Devon’s footprint in key producing regions and provide a more diversified portfolio. The report also pointed to potential improvements in free cash flow generation and capital allocation flexibility as additional drivers. While specific financial targets were not disclosed in the coverage, Jefferies’ outlook suggests that the deal’s benefits could become more apparent as integration progresses. The analyst commentary comes amid a broader backdrop of consolidation within the energy sector, where companies seek to optimize their asset bases amid volatile commodity prices. Devon Energy has not yet released earnings for the second quarter of 2026, but its most recent quarterly results showed a stable operational performance against industry benchmarks. Market participants continue to monitor the company’s integration progress and any further strategic moves. The Coterra deal provides Devon with a larger, more contiguous acreage footprint, which could lead to cost savings through shared infrastructure and optimized drilling schedules. However, execution risks remain, and the timing of synergies realization may vary. Market observers note that the success of such transactions often hinges on integration speed and the ability to maintain operational momentum. Devon’s management has previously demonstrated capability in executing large-scale deals, but the current commodity price environment adds an element of uncertainty. While the outlook presents potential, investors should consider that energy stocks are inherently tied to macroeconomic factors such as global demand, OPEC+ decisions, and regulatory changes. The cautious language used by Jefferies—highlighting “potential catalysts” rather than guaranteed outcomes—indicates a recognition that market conditions can shift. For now, the focus remains on how Devon captures the promised benefits of the Coterra deal while navigating a volatile energy landscape.
